Non-windows guests crash on headphones connect or disconnect

Description
Steps to reproduce:
- start a guest
- wait for it to boot (for linux crash can't be reproduced in grub menu, in the beginning of a boot sequence, but after some point in a boot sequence it can be reproduced every time (regardless of whether X11 is started or not)
- connect or disconnect headphones (tested with both regular wired headphones and bluetooth headphones). Alternatively you may just click on volume icon in macOS system tray and select different audio output device.
Expected result: guest continues to work, using new active audio output
Actual result: guest crashes (crash report attached)
Host: macOS Sierra 10.12.6 (16G29)
Guests crashing:
- Linux nixos 4.9.39 #1-NixOS SMP Fri Jul 21 05:42:36 UTC 2017 x86_64 GNU/Linux (guest additions installed)
- Haiku shredder 1 hrev51050 Mar 28 2017 17:40:13 BePC x86 Haiku (no guest additions)
Guests not crashing:
- Microsoft Windows [Version 10.0.14393] (guest additions installed)
- KolibriOS v0.7.7.0. Kernel SVN-rev.: 6880 (no guest additions)
Tested on both latest stable and latest test (Version 5.1.27 r117314 (Qt5.6.2)) build. Virtualbox extensions are installed.
